Celebrating the life of Lavoy Green

January 27, 1935 - June 3, 2026

Lavoy Green, master machinist, skilled woodworker, and professional finder-of-loopholes, officially clocked out of his earthly shift on June 3, 2026, in Palestine, TX, at the ripe old age of 91. Born in Sasakwa, OK on January 27, 1935, Lavoy spent most of his life in Tuttle, OK, perfecting the arts of precision, patience, and making people laugh.

A proud veteran, Lavoy served in the U.S. Army where he undoubtedly kept his platoon entertained. He later turned his sharp eye and steady hands to a career as a machinist and a lifelong passion for woodworking. If it was made of wood, he could build it, if it was broken, he could fix it; and if it was a quiet room, he could fill it with a joke.

Lavoy has finally gone to reunite with his favorite supervisor, his beloved wife, Kathern Green, to whom he was married for 54 wonderful years. We suspect Kathy is currently correcting his posture and asking him what took him so long.

He leaves behind a legacy of love, laughter, and sawdust, inherited by his two daughters and their husbands, Julie and Wayne Bell, and Jill and William Niffer Davis. He is also survived by his grandchildren, who promise to pass down his sense of humor: Katie Beth Shouse, Danielle Guin, Seth Shouse, Jon Bell, Jarod Bell, and Jackson Bell. His legendary status will live on through his great-grandchildren: Izzy Lynch, Mason Guin, Maverick Bell, Ezra Bell, and Emery Wilson. He is also survived by baby Guin expected in January 2027.

Lavoy’s memorial service will be held on Friday, July 10, 2026 at Tuttle Methodist Church at 10:00 a.m. under the direction of Sevier Funeral Home. The family has requested in honor of Lavoy’s memory--please do not wear black to the memorial service.

In lieu of flowers, donations may be made in Lavoy Green’s name to Tuttle Methodist Church.
